K.M. Shea

135 books

missing page info digital

fiction fantasy romance young adult

15 pages digital

1131 pages digital 2014

fiction fantasy romance

114 pages paperback 2018

fiction fantasy adventurous emotional mysterious fast-paced

7 pages digital

fiction fantasy adventurous dark mysterious medium-paced

11 pages digital

fiction fantasy adventurous dark mysterious medium-paced

11 pages digital

adventurous dark mysterious medium-paced

322 pages digital 2021

fiction fantasy romance adventurous funny lighthearted medium-paced

5 pages digital not a book user-added

fiction fantasy

missing page info